When you think of the world’s golf hot spots it would be fair to say Iceland doesn’t spring immediately to mind.
But not only is the Nordic country golf mad (the game is second only to football in participation) but it is home to some of the world’s most interesting courses.
Icelandic course architect Edwin Roald is one of the industry’s most thoughtful and eloquent speakers and in this wide-ranging chat with host Rod Morri, he introduces us to golf in Iceland as well as offering thought provoking takes on topics as broad as golf as a vehicle for carbon capture as well as social harmony.
